Lieli is a village in the canton of Lucerne, Switzerland. The former municipality of the district of Hochdorf merged with Hohenrain on January 1, 2007, to form Hohenrain.1
History
Lieli is first mentioned around the year 900 as Lielae. In the local Swiss German dialect, it was known as Nieli as far back as the 17th Century.2

Demographics
The historical population is given in the following table:2
| year | population |
|---|---|
| 1678 | 258 |
| 1798 | 211 |
| 1850 | 244 |
| 1900 | 193 |
| 1950 | 199 |
| 1980 | 142 |
